Join us for an in-depth technical demonstration of DMN Boxed Expressions, a powerful yet often overlooked feature of the Decision Model and Notation™(DMN™) standard.
This session is part of our ongoing tech demo series, which explores key DMN capabilities. We'll explore how Boxed Expressions address the challenge of sharing business formulas and logic across different Decision Requirement Diagrams (DRDs), enabling greater reusability, consistency, and efficiency in decision modeling.
You'll learn how to create, implement, and leverage various types of Boxed Expressions, from simple contexts and functions to more advanced conditionals and iterators.
Join Ian Teague and Adrian Nagorski for a live demonstration of how these tabular expressions can be used to standardize decision logic, eliminate redundancy, and ensure consistency across your decision models.
Whether you're a business analyst, decision modeler, or technical implementer, this webinar will equip you with the knowledge to take your DMN implementations to the next level by creating reusable, shareable logic components that business users can understand without worrying about any hidden complexity.
